Common everyday pitfalls often overlooked:
Overfilling the water.
A classic mistake! Overfilling past the "max" line might seem convenient, but it's actually dangerous: water can overflow from the spout and splash. It also overloads the automatic shut-off mechanism and wears out the seals prematurely. In short: only fill it to the correct level.
